When a snap does not have an icon, gnome-software uses the Snapcraft
logo as a substitute.

This is not a good idea, because:
- It gives the Snapcraft logo an association of “something is missing”.
- It gives the Snapcraft logo an association with a snap that might be terrible.

What should happen: Snaps without icons should have a generic icon that
does not include the Snapcraft logo.
